However, later the 1200 was available in both silver and matte black finishes (in Japan, the introduction of the MK3 in 1989 marked the first official introduction of a black version). Since 1997, the MK2 had the pitch slide potentiometer changed from 6 pin to 8 pin mounting with part number SFDZ122N11 and later from 20k ohm to 22k ohm, part number SFDZ122N11-1 up until late 1996. After which part number SFDZ122N11-2 was the preferred option which had a +/- 0.5mm quartz travel lock, much shorter than previous versions. This meant that the null point on the centre voltage tap was slightly bigger thus removing the quartz lock conflict.

In addition, the adjustable rubber-damped feet insulated against acoustic feedback, which can be a serious problem when operating a turntable in close proximity to loudspeakers (a common situation for DJs). The underside of the platter is coated with a 1.2mm layer of rubber to reduce ringing and the platter design is reliant on the use of the supplied 2mm rubber mat. Most users remove the rubber turntable mat and replace it with a slipmat for mixing. However, without the rubber mat, the platter is prone to resonance at 250 Hz when used near a large club sound system.

pitch control is digital which will be the standard for all 1200 models from this point on. It also features blue target lights and blue pitch-number illumination. The brake strength potentiometer, although still located beneath platter, can now be adjusted, unlike previous models, using a small plastic knob. Minor improvements over Mk2, Mk3, Mk4, & 1200LTD include improved tonearm mounting and oxygen-free copper wire, improved vibration damping in the body, improvements to pitch control accuracy and better LEDs. Available as 120 volt model for the North American market.

cast platter which brings an overall weight difference between the G/GAE. The G/GAE and GR both use what are essentially the same 9-pole motor. Whereas the G has twin rotors, the GR has a single rotor, giving it less torque. The GR differs from the G in its use of a feedback generator coil system (as used in the original SL1200) instead of an optical encoder.

Released on 1 November 2002, this has a glossy black finish with silver speckles. It was a special 30th-anniversary edition. This model came in satin black metallic finish and is nearly the same in function as the SL-1200MK2, although some of the circuitry inside is updated to use fewer types of pots and resistors. Released in summer of 1979. this model came in both silver and matte black. The matte black version was available for a limited time in the US market in a 2 pack SL-1200MK2PK. Announced in January 2017 CES, the GR model is a stripped-down budget version of the G, cutting the price tag more than half at an approximate MSRP of ÂŁ1,299 / US$ 1,700. A Technics SL-1200G turntable with the platter removed reveals the top of the newly designed coreless direct drive motor assembly. In contrast to older models, the platter has no magnet ring on the backside, but is bolted directly onto the motor assembly instead, using three flathead

The MK7 models were launched as the first new Technics standard DJ turntable in approximately nine years. The MK7, along with the Grand Class models, no longer have "QUARTZ" printed on the plinth nor dust cover.

Released on 12 December 2007 (in Japan) as a special 35th-anniversary Limited edition of 1200 units. It consisted of a standard black MK6 packaged up with a booklet and gold record.

The Technics EPA-120 tonearm was standard equipment on the original SL-1200 and was significantly different than the tonearm introduced with the MK2 and subsequent models.

Released in 1989, has a matte black finish like the MK2, gold RCA plugs, and a small gold-foil Technics label on the back. It was destined only for the Japanese market.

This was partially achieved through the fact that the SL1210/1200 made the platter a part of the motor mechanism.

SL-1210MK5 has a black finish like the MK2, and is 'functionally' exactly the same as the SL-1200MK5.

Japan only, factory gold RCA cables, black or silver finish. Pitch reset button. Released in 1997.

This model is the same as the SL-1200M3D except with a matte black finish like the MK2.
